A common question people ask of those who run a dentist practice is how they can whiten their teeth through natural and organic means.

Everyone wants whiter teeth, but few want to use harsh chemicals or inorganic compounds to make this happen. Fortunately, there are many ways you can whiten teeth organically.

Here are 8 of the best:

  1. Mixing Baking Soda, Salt and Lemon Juice with Your Toothpaste

To employ this method, mix the following ingredients in a bowl:

  • 1 tablespoon of toothpaste
  • 1 pinch each of baking soda and salt
  • 4-5 drops of lemon juice

After you have mixed all the ingredients, brush your teeth with this mixture for about 5 minutes.

While you should see results after just one application of the mixture, you should not use this method more than once every two months.

  1. Teeth-Whitening Foods

Many tasty and healthy-to-eat foods can also whiten your teeth, such as fruit, dairy and crunchy vegetables. These foods include:

  • Cheese
  • Strawberries
  • Carrots
  • Celery
  • Broccoli
  • Cucumbers

Results may vary by individual, so try a few of these foods and see which ones work best for you.

  1. Apple Cider Vinegar

Apple Cider Vinegar is particularly adept at removing tough stains on your teeth. To use this method, add a teaspoon of vinegar to half a cup of water, so to dilute its acidity. Then, swish this mixture in your mouth for about a half-minute before spitting it out and rinsing your mouth with water alone. Finally, do not brush your teeth for a half-hour afterward, as this could remove enamel from your teeth.

  1. Oil Pulling

This is a traditional Indian method of whitening your teeth that will also remove various toxins from your mouth while improving your overall oral hygiene as well. To use this method, swish a teaspoon of natural oil, such as coconut oil or sunflower oil, in your mouth for about 20 minutes. Then, spit it out and rinse your mouth with water.

  1. Organic Turmeric Powder

Organic turmeric powder has a natural and mild abrasiveness that can remove stains from your teeth. It is also anti-inflammatory and antimicrobial, so it also improves overall oral hygiene. To use this method, mix a teaspoon of organic turmeric powder with a dash of water. Then, brush your teeth with this for two minutes before rinsing and brushing with normal toothpaste. Just be careful when cleaning up, as turmeric can stains some sinks.

  1. Kissing

While you probably know that kissing can be enjoyable, you probably did not know that it can actually whiten your teeth. Kissing does this because it increases saliva production, which, in turn, helps removes stains from your teeth. You can also increase saliva production by chewing gum and by sucking on a candy. Though if you do either of these things, make sure you select a sugar-free variety.

  1. Banana Peels

Banana peels (as well as orange rinds) contain vitamins and minerals that have been known to whiten teeth. To use this method, rubs the inside of the peels against your teeth for a few minutes. Then, wait 10 minutes and brush your teeth as you would normally do.

  1. Charcoal

While it may seem counterintuitive, activated charcoal is actually a great way to whiten your teeth. It is also a cheap and easy way to do it. Simply take a charcoal tablet and crush it into a powder. Then, after you wet your clean toothbrush under water, dip the bristles into the charcoal and brush your teeth like you would normally do for 2 minutes.

In conclusion, keep in mind that it is not recommended to try all of these methods at once. Instead, try one or two of them at a time for a short period and see which of them works best for you. Also, if you are having any kind of problems with your teeth, you should visit a dentist and fix these problems before trying to whiten your teeth yourself.
